This fine-toothed Ryoba Seiun Saku 210 from Gyokucho finds its application in the fine processing of wood. The saw blade of this saw has fine teeth (17 TPI) on one side. The other side is particularly suitable for longitudinal cuts.
Use this Japanese saw for cutting fine wood and panel material made of MDF, plywood and plastic.
Carpenters, interior designers, restorers and other fine woodworkers choose this saw when precision is important.
The wooden handle is wrapped in rattan in the traditional style and the saw blade is very easy to replace.
The teeth of this Japanese saw are hardened to a surface hardness of 68 to 71 HRC. This makes the teeth hard and durable on the outside. This is important for the characteristic high-quality cutting properties.
Comes with a plastic teethguard.
